小程序维护手册模板工具:10套可复用框架快速上手

在小程序开发迭代的全生命周期中,一份科学规范的小程序维护手册是保障项目长期稳定运行的核心资产。它不仅能帮助开发团队高效定位问题、梳理版本迭代脉络,还能降低新人上手成本,实现知识沉淀与传承。本文将为开发者提供10套可复用的小程序维护手册模板框架,助力快速搭建适配不同场景的维护体系。

一、小程序维护手册模板结构:模块化设计,覆盖全生命周期

1. 基础信息模块

基础信息模块是小程序维护手册的“身份证”,需包含项目核心元数据。具体内容包括:

  • 项目概述:小程序的核心定位、目标用户群体、主要功能亮点及上线时间等基础信息,帮助维护人员快速了解项目背景。
  • 技术栈清单:详细罗列前端框架(如原生小程序框架、Taro、UniApp等)、后端服务架构(如Node.js、Java Spring Boot等)、数据库类型(如MySQL、MongoDB)及第三方依赖库版本信息,为技术排查提供依据。
  • 团队分工表:明确产品、开发、测试、运维等角色的负责人及联系方式,确保问题发生时能快速对接对应人员。

2. 版本迭代模块

版本迭代模块记录小程序从上线到当前版本的所有更新历史,是追溯功能变更与问题根源的关键依据。模块内容包括:

  • 版本号管理规则:遵循语义化版本规范(如MAJOR.MINOR.PATCH),明确主版本、次版本和修订版本的更新标准,例如主版本号变更对应重大功能重构,次版本号对应新功能上线,修订版本号对应Bug修复。
  • 版本更新日志:按时间倒序记录每个版本的更新内容,包括新增功能、优化点、修复的Bug及影响范围。每条日志需关联对应的需求文档链接或Bug跟踪系统编号,便于后续查阅。
  • 版本回滚方案:制定版本回滚的触发条件、操作步骤及回滚后的验证流程,当新版本出现严重问题时能快速恢复到稳定版本。

3. 运维监控模块

运维监控模块聚焦小程序上线后的稳定性保障,帮助团队实时掌握系统运行状态。模块内容包括:

  • 监控指标体系:定义核心监控指标,如页面加载时间、接口响应时长、错误率、用户留存率等,并设置预警阈值。例如,当接口响应时长超过500ms时触发告警,提醒运维人员排查问题。
  • 告警处理流程:明确不同级别的告警(如严重、一般、提示)对应的处理责任人及响应时间要求,建立从告警接收到问题解决的闭环管理机制。
  • 性能优化指南:针对常见性能瓶颈(如包体积过大、图片资源未优化)提供优化方案及实施步骤,持续提升小程序运行效率。

4. 故障排查模块

故障排查模块是解决线上问题的“急救手册”,需覆盖小程序运行过程中常见的故障类型及排查方法。模块内容包括:

  • 常见故障分类:将故障分为前端渲染异常、接口调用失败、数据同步错误、第三方服务异常等类别,并针对每类故障提供详细的排查步骤。例如,当出现前端渲染异常时,可按照“检查网络连接→查看控制台报错信息→排查代码逻辑→验证缓存数据”的流程进行排查。
  • 故障案例库:收集历史故障案例,记录故障现象、排查过程、解决方案及预防措施,形成可复用的故障处理知识库。
  • 紧急联系人清单:列出第三方服务提供商(如云服务器厂商、支付平台、地图服务商)的技术支持联系方式,当出现第三方服务异常时能快速对接解决。

5. 安全管理模块

安全管理模块聚焦小程序的信息安全与合规性,防范数据泄露、恶意攻击等风险。模块内容包括:

  • 数据安全规范:明确用户数据的存储、传输、使用及销毁规则,遵循《网络安全法》《个人信息保护法》等法律法规要求。例如,用户敏感信息需加密存储,传输过程采用HTTPS协议。
  • 权限管理机制:建立严格的权限管理体系,区分开发、测试、生产环境的访问权限,避免因权限滥用导致的安全风险。例如,生产环境的数据库操作仅允许指定运维人员执行。
  • 安全漏洞排查指南:定期对小程序进行安全漏洞扫描,针对常见漏洞类型(如SQL注入、XSS攻击)提供排查方法及修复方案。

二、小程序维护手册使用方法:三步快速上手

1. 模板选择与初始化

根据小程序的项目类型、规模及发展阶段选择合适的模板框架。例如,初创团队的轻量级小程序可选择基础版模板,重点覆盖基础信息、版本迭代及故障排查模块;大型企业级小程序则需选择完整版模板,全面涵盖运维监控、安全管理等模块。模板初始化时,需根据项目实际情况替换模板中的占位符信息,如项目名称、技术栈清单等。

2. 内容填充与更新

在小程序开发及运维过程中,实时更新维护手册内容。版本迭代后及时补充更新日志,故障解决后完善故障案例库,安全漏洞修复后更新安全管理模块。建议建立“每次版本上线必更手册”的机制,确保手册内容与项目实际状态保持一致。同时,可借助文档协作工具(如腾讯文档、飞书文档)实现多人实时编辑,提高内容更新效率。

3. 团队培训与落地应用

组织团队成员开展维护手册培训,确保每个成员熟悉手册结构及使用方法。在日常工作中,要求开发人员在提交代码时关联对应版本的更新日志,测试人员在提交Bug时参考故障排查模块的流程进行描述,运维人员在处理告警时按照运维监控模块的指引进行操作。定期对手册使用情况进行复盘,收集团队反馈并优化手册内容,提升手册的实用性与易用性。

三、小程序维护手册适配场景:覆盖不同类型项目需求

1. 初创团队轻量级小程序

初创团队的轻量级小程序通常具有功能简单、迭代速度快的特点,维护手册需重点突出简洁性与实用性。建议选择基础版模板,聚焦基础信息、版本迭代及故障排查模块。例如,一家初创公司开发的餐饮外卖小程序,维护手册可重点记录小程序的核心功能、技术栈及常见订单异常的排查方法,帮助团队快速解决日常运营中遇到的问题。

2. 大型企业级小程序

大型企业级小程序涉及多部门协作、复杂业务逻辑及海量用户数据,维护手册需具备全面性与规范性。建议选择完整版模板,覆盖基础信息、版本迭代、运维监控、故障排查及安全管理等所有模块。例如,某电商平台的官方小程序,维护手册需详细记录系统架构、性能监控指标、安全漏洞排查流程及应急响应机制,保障小程序在大促期间稳定运行。

3. 第三方外包项目小程序

第三方外包项目小程序的维护手册需兼顾交接效率与后续维护便利性。建议在模板中增加项目交接模块,详细记录项目开发过程中的关键文档链接、代码仓库地址、服务器配置信息及第三方服务账号密码等内容。同时,提供清晰的维护指南,帮助甲方团队在项目交接后快速上手维护工作。

四、小程序维护手册自定义技巧:打造个性化维护体系

1. 模块扩展与删减

根据项目实际需求对模板模块进行扩展或删减。例如,若小程序涉及多端同步(如微信小程序、支付宝小程序、抖音小程序),可增加多端适配模块,记录不同平台的特性差异及适配方案;若项目不涉及复杂的运维监控需求,可简化运维监控模块的内容,重点保留核心监控指标及告警处理流程。

2. 可视化优化

通过图表、流程图等可视化元素提升维护手册的可读性。例如,用甘特图展示版本迭代时间线,用流程图呈现故障排查流程,用饼图展示不同类型故障的占比情况。可视化元素不仅能让复杂信息更直观易懂,还能提高团队成员查阅手册的效率。

3. 自动化集成

将维护手册与项目管理工具、开发流程工具进行自动化集成,提升手册内容更新的及时性与准确性。例如,配置Git钩子,当代码提交到指定分支时自动触发版本更新日志的生成;集成Bug跟踪系统,当Bug状态变更时自动同步到故障排查模块的案例库中。

五、小程序维护手册使用注意事项:规避常见误区

1. 避免“一次性”编写

部分团队在项目上线初期编写维护手册后便不再更新,导致手册内容与项目实际情况脱节。需建立手册更新的常态化机制,将手册更新纳入项目迭代流程,确保手册内容随项目发展同步更新。

2. 避免过度冗余

维护手册应简洁实用,避免堆砌无关信息。例如,在记录版本更新日志时,只需描述核心变更内容,无需详细罗列代码修改细节;在故障案例库中,重点记录典型故障的解决方案,避免重复记录类似问题。

3. 注重文档安全性

维护手册中可能包含项目敏感信息(如数据库密码、第三方服务密钥),需采取加密存储、权限控制等措施保障文档安全。例如,将维护手册存储在企业内部文档管理系统中,设置不同角色的访问权限,避免敏感信息泄露。

六、结尾:让小程序维护手册成为项目稳定运行的“压舱石”

小程序维护手册不仅是一份文档,更是项目知识沉淀与传承的载体。通过选择合适的模板框架、掌握正确的使用方法、适配不同场景的需求、运用自定义技巧并规避常见误区,开发者可以快速搭建科学规范的小程序维护体系。在小程序的全生命周期中,持续完善维护手册内容,让其成为保障项目稳定运行、提升团队协作效率的核心资产,助力小程序实现长期健康发展。